Job Description
A leading international financial institution is seeking a highly organised, bilingual Executive Assistant to provide top-level support to its London-based General Manager and members of the senior leadership team. This is a broad and high-exposure role, requiring discretion, maturity, and a proactive mindset.
You will play a central role in supporting the business across diary and meeting management, coordination with European head offices, event planning, and internal communications. The position offers a long-term opportunity within a stable and respected financial environment.
Key responsibilities include:
Extensive diary management for the General Manager and senior team members
Coordinating internal and external meetings, including leadership committees and strategic reviews
Planning and hosting senior international visitors, ensuring smooth logistics and client-facing presentation
Organising travel arrangements (mainly within Europe) and preparing related documents
Supporting internal events (offsites, investor briefings, partnership breakfasts, etc.)
Preparing presentations and attending meetings when needed to take notes or minutes
Acting as gatekeeper with diplomacy and discretion
Supervising a team assistant and providing occasional cover for reception in exceptional cases
